URS of Octagonal Blender

OBJECTIVE for URS of Octagonal Blender:

This document is generating for the purpose of specifying the URS of Octagonal Blender. The URS of Octagonal Blender is provided to define the important components, variables and options necessary for the Supplier to provide a functional of Octagonal Blender that meets the needs in the most cost-effective method possible.  The URS is also provided to the Supplier to provide a price quote for the supply for multi-mill machine including the design, Performance and manufacture of the equipment. The purpose of this document is to detail the basic guidelines to the vendor for the purpose of fabricating the Octagonal Blender as per the defined specifications. It is the foremost and the basic requirement of a facility, equipment, process and system as envisaged by the project team and management.

SCOPE OF SERVICES:

Design of Octagonal Blender shall meet with WHO and cGMP Guide Lines.

Commissioning include supervision and erection of system and their alignments. Trial run of system is to be taken with and without load as per specified capacities at shop and after installation.

Our offer shall be complete with literature and catalogue of all the items offered, process flow diagrams and equipment the information required on the equipment specs such as dimensions, electrical details, utility requirement, utility hook-up details, installation drawings, P & IDs (Process and Instrumentation Diagrams), etc.

The installation shall meet with the highest standards of cGMP and international standards of construction.

Exclusion from Scope of Supply:

  • All Civil Work.
  • Electric supply, wherever required.

TECHNICAL REQUIREMENTS FOR URS of Octagonal Blender:

Documentations:

Relevant catalogues and technical details in duplicate to be given with DQ.

Layout showing overall dimensions for each item of system and dimensions of base to be submitted at the earliest for approval.

Power and services requirements for each item of the system.

Safety features.

Change parts requirement, if any.

Complete technical specifications.

Type of finishes in terms of Ra/grits.

All instruments/ gauges/controls including electronic controls should be calibrated and calibration certificates along with calibration procedure followed to be provided (traceability to National Standards to be informed by vendor). Vendor should recommend frequency for calibration of instrument/ gauges/controls.

Certificates for the following should be provided wherever applicable. MOC & Performance Test.

Design Qualification (DQ) and General assembly Drawings shall be submitted to us within two weeks after issuance of Purchase Order. Installation Qualification (IQ), Operational Qualification (OQ) and Performance Qualification (PQ) shall be done at our end as per the approved Protocol..

Operation and maintenance manuals shall be submitted prior to equipment delivery, as early as possible.

All equipment drawings as built to be submitted for records in triplicate.

The service requirement equipment shall be clearly indicated. The service hook-up details to be provided.

Commissioning methods and commissioning tests/Qualification/Acceptance criteria shall be specified either in operational manual or in commissioning document to be submitted prior to delivery of equipment at the earliest.

Construction certificate shall be provided with the system.

Training to operators to be carried out and documented evidence to be submitted.

Details and frequency of Preventive maintenance is to be provided.

Draft SOP for the operation & Changeover is to be provided before any Qualification activity is under taken.

Finishing and Line Balancing:

Interfacing/ integration/ line balancing of all items of process equipment shall be the responsibility of supplier. For this purpose, if additional equipment is required, vendor shall specify it. This will include:

Working Heights.

Process Controller.

Stare Casing/ Ladder.

Process Speed Variation.

Emergency Stops.

Required interlocks between the machines are to be provided by vendor.

All parts in contact with product materials are of SS 316 L unless otherwise specified.

Vendor shall specify requirements of associated civil works for the equipment offered including cut outs, inserts and foundation etc. well in advance.

Vendor to provide detailed information on dust control system, if any.

All external finishes to be uniform satin (Matt finish) and internal finishes to be mirror polished (320 Grits) for metal surfaces in product contact.

All welds in contact surface are to be crevice free, ground smooth. The equipment shall be designed and constructed to suit its intended use and to facilitate maintenance as well as easy cleaning is possible from every side of the machine.

The equipment offered should comply with internationally approved Good Engineering Practices (GEP) standards and the contractor should specify the standards to which each piece of equipment complies with like CE etc.

All valves in the equipment shall be in accordance with process requirement and shall be of hygienic/sanitary design.

All asbestos free insulation wherever applicable shall be suitably cladded with SS 304 with uniform satin finish so that it is non-shedding.

All connections shall be tri-clamps type and not screw type.

All Machine corners are (both internal and external) are to be rounded off to ease cleaning.

Electrical:

Power panel should be made up of mild steel powder coated, self supporting to be installed in technical area.

Power panel should consist of MCBs, Overload relay, terminal, contractor and selector.

All drive motors to be flameproof suitable for 415 V ± 5%, 3 Phase, 50 ±5% Hz.

Octagonal Blender offered should be guaranteed for workmanship and quality of materials for a minimum period of one year from the date of commissioning.

All system to be provided with over head relay for protection against single phasing and low voltage.

All bought out items / Motors /Sub Module should be of reputed make meeting International Standards.

All system accessories offered should be guaranteed for workmanship and quality of materials for a minimum period of one year from the date of commissioning.

SALIENT FEATURES:

Machine should be on PLC based control with HMI control.

Emergency stop button should be easily assessable.

Blender at vertical position.

The Octagonal Bin is provided with a suitable opening with necessary seals for loading of material. A butterfly valve is provided for discharge of material.

Blender RPM should be between 3 to 16 RPM.

SAFETY FEATURES for URS of Octagonal Blender:

Octagonal Blender should have the following features:

  1. Emergency Stops.
  2. Safety switches for railing open.
  3. Vacuum pump over load proxy switches should be provided.

TECHNICAL SPECIFICATIONS for URS of Octagonal Blender

DESCRIPTIONSPECIFICATION
Machine TypeOctagonal Blender
Basic MachineSturdy Mild Steel Structure enclosed with Stainless Steel Guards.Base plate with holes for foundation bolts. Made of Mild Steel with SS cladding.
Octagonal ShellMOC:- SS316 LCapacity :- 2000 L.
Charging PortPCS System port should be provided for Automatic Charging
Discharging PortØ10” Butterfly Valve Pneumatic operated with actuator.
Contacts Parts Surface FinishInner Surface: Mirror Polished (0.5 m Ra).Outer Surface: Matt Polished (0.8 m Ra).
Control PanelMade of Stainless Steel 304 ( Machine Mounted) Consisting of: PLC based controlsInching optionBlending time & RPM display in HMI.
Power PanelMS Painted panel installed inside the machine. MCBs, TerminalContactors, AC DriveSMPSCooling FanVoltmeterMain rotary switch
SwitchMagnetic switch use for Railing & Guards

Scope of Work:

The Octagonal Blender distribution package should include design, engineering, manufacture, testing at works, packaging and forwarding, transportation, unloading at site, storage, erection, start up, installation and commissioning.

It should also include all accessories and control instrumentation such as but not restricted to the following:

  • Start up and commissioning spares required shall be specified clearly in your offer.
  • Inspection shall be as per specification.
  • Documentation shall be as per specification.

In case of any deviation of scope of supplies and services as specified in the offer, contractor to clearly highlight the same.

Contractor to follow legend GA drawing and adhere to the equipment for maintaining consistency.

Material of Construction:

  • The product contact parts should be made of buffed S.S. 316 L.
  • Main frame made out of M.S. with S.S. 304 cladding.
  • Control panel should be made up of SS 304.
  • Safety Railing should be made up of SS 304.
